Where to Buy Phlebotomy Supplies With Fast Shipping in the United States

Summary

  • Fast Phlebotomy Supply delivery in the United States usually comes from national medical distributors, laboratory suppliers, manufacturer-direct programs, and local hospital or clinical supply networks.
  • Shipping speed should be evaluated alongside product quality, regulatory compliance, expiration dates, lot tracking, storage requirements, return policies, and total delivered cost.
  • Clinics can reduce delays by forecasting usage, standardizing products, maintaining safety stock, using multiple approved suppliers, and confirming inventory before placing urgent orders.

Healthcare facilities in the United States often need phlebotomy supplies quickly. A clinic may run short of blood collection tubes after an unexpected increase in patient volume. A Mobile Phlebotomy service may need additional needles, tourniquets, and specimen bags before a scheduled group visit. A newly opened physician office may need a complete collection setup before it can begin seeing patients. In each situation, shipping speed matters, but speed should not come at the expense of safety, regulatory compliance, or reliable product quality.

The best place to buy phlebotomy supplies with fast shipping depends on the type of organization, the products required, the delivery location, and whether the order is routine or urgent. National medical distributors often provide broad product selection and predictable delivery schedules. Laboratory suppliers may specialize in blood collection tubes and specimen-handling products. Manufacturers can be useful for recurring, high-volume purchases. Local distributors and medical supply stores may provide same-day pickup or next-day delivery in selected metropolitan areas.

Phlebotomy purchasing also involves more than finding the lowest listed price. Supplies must be compatible with laboratory analyzers and collection procedures. They should arrive with sufficient shelf life, intact packaging, correct labeling, and appropriate storage conditions. Facilities must also consider the Occupational Safety and Health Administration Bloodborne Pathogens Standard, Clinical Laboratory Improvement Amendments requirements, state Regulations, and internal infection-prevention policies.

Where Healthcare Organizations Commonly Purchase Phlebotomy Supplies

There is no single supplier that is fastest for every buyer. A rural clinic, a large hospital, an independent laboratory, and a mobile blood-draw service may all use different purchasing channels. The following options are commonly used in the United States.

National medical and laboratory distributors

Large national distributors are often the first choice for routine phlebotomy purchasing. These companies typically stock needles, blood collection tubes, syringes, tube holders, safety devices, tourniquets, alcohol prep pads, gauze, adhesive bandages, specimen bags, transport containers, sharps containers, and personal protective equipment.

Their primary advantage is distribution infrastructure. A large distributor may operate multiple regional warehouses and provide scheduled delivery routes to medical offices, hospitals, laboratories, and long-term care facilities. Many offer business accounts, electronic ordering systems, contract pricing, recurring orders, and shipment tracking. Depending on inventory and location, standard products may arrive within one to three business days, while expedited services may be available for an additional charge.

However, buyers should not assume that every item shown in an online catalog is physically available. Some listings may be backordered, allocated, drop-shipped from a manufacturer, or subject to minimum-order requirements. Before placing an urgent order, confirm the available quantity, warehouse location, cutoff time, estimated delivery date, and whether the product will ship in one package or several separate shipments.

Specialty laboratory suppliers

Specialty laboratory suppliers may be particularly useful when a facility needs specific blood collection tubes, specimen-processing products, or laboratory-compatible accessories. They often understand tube additives, specimen stability, centrifugation requirements, order-of-draw procedures, and analyzer compatibility better than general medical retailers.

These suppliers can be a good choice for laboratories that require serum separator tubes, plasma preparation tubes, trace-element tubes, coagulation tubes, microbiology collection systems, pediatric tubes, or specialty transport products. They may also carry laboratory labels, requisition materials, bar-code supplies, and specimen bags that are difficult to find through general healthcare retailers.

Fast delivery still depends on inventory. Specialty products may be manufactured in smaller quantities and may have longer lead times than commonly used needles or gauze. A laboratory should ask whether a substitute product has been validated or approved by its laboratory director before changing tube brands or additives.

Manufacturer-direct purchasing

Buying directly from a manufacturer can be beneficial for hospitals, reference laboratories, physician groups, and other organizations with predictable, high-volume demand. Direct purchasing may offer contract pricing, dedicated account support, product standardization, usage reporting, and scheduled replenishment programs.

Manufacturer-direct purchasing is also helpful when a facility needs a particular safety-engineered device or a collection system that must be consistent across multiple locations. Standardization can reduce training complexity and lower the risk of selecting an incompatible component.

The disadvantage is that manufacturers may have higher minimum order quantities or longer standard lead times. A direct account may not be the fastest solution for a small emergency order unless the manufacturer maintains regional inventory or offers expedited fulfillment. Smaller practices should compare the total cost, including freight, minimum quantities, storage space, and expiration-related waste.

Local medical supply companies

Local and regional medical supply companies can be valuable when speed is the highest priority. Some offer same-day delivery, local pickup, or direct communication with a sales representative who can verify inventory immediately. This can be especially important for clinics in major metropolitan areas or communities served by established healthcare distribution networks.

Local vendors may also be able to provide practical assistance, such as identifying a compatible substitute, locating a discontinued item, or arranging a partial emergency shipment. Their product range may be narrower than that of a national distributor, so buyers should confirm whether the available items meet the facility’s clinical and regulatory requirements.

When using a local supplier, verify that products are new, sealed, traceable, and obtained through an authorized distribution channel. A low price is not an advantage if the item lacks reliable lot information, has a short expiration date, or arrives with damaged packaging.

Medical supply stores and business-to-business marketplaces

Online medical supply stores and business-to-business marketplaces may offer rapid fulfillment for commonly used items. These channels can be convenient for small physician offices, home health agencies, nursing schools, occupational health programs, and Mobile Phlebotomy services.

They are often suitable for products such as nonsterile gloves, tourniquets, gauze, bandages, alcohol wipes, disposable gowns, specimen bags, and sharps containers. They may be less suitable for specialized blood collection tubes or safety devices unless the seller provides complete manufacturer information and confirms compatibility.

Marketplace purchasing requires additional due diligence. The buyer should determine whether the seller is the manufacturer, an authorized distributor, or an independent reseller. Product pages should identify the manufacturer, catalog number, package quantity, expiration information when applicable, and applicable regulatory details. Facilities should be cautious about unusually low prices, unclear descriptions, mixed product photographs, and listings that do not distinguish sterile from nonsterile supplies.

Local hospitals, health systems, and group purchasing organizations

Hospitals and large health systems commonly purchase through group purchasing organizations or negotiated distributor contracts. Smaller affiliated practices may be able to use the same approved vendor, product catalog, or emergency procurement process. This can provide access to established quality controls, standardized products, and existing delivery routes.

A hospital’s central supply department may also be able to help during a short-term shortage, although interdepartmental transfers must follow the organization’s inventory, billing, and infection-control policies. A clinic should not assume that another facility can legally or operationally transfer products without documentation.

Group purchasing arrangements may reduce unit prices, but they can limit brand choice or require the use of contracted products. Buyers should review whether the contract includes expedited shipping, emergency order procedures, substitutions, and back-order notifications.

Which Phlebotomy Supplies Are Usually Available for Fast Delivery?

Fast-shipping availability is generally strongest for high-volume, standardized products. These items are commonly stocked by multiple distributors and manufacturers:

  1. Safety blood collection needles in common gauges and lengths.
  2. Multi-sample needle holders and compatible tube holders.
  3. Evacuated blood collection tubes for routine chemistry, hematology, and coagulation testing.
  4. Winged blood collection sets, commonly called butterfly needles.
  5. Disposable tourniquets and reusable tourniquets approved for clinical use.
  6. Alcohol prep pads, Chlorhexidine products, and other approved skin antiseptics.
  7. Nonsterile and sterile gloves in common sizes.
  8. Gauze, adhesive bandages, cotton-tipped applicators, and medical tape.
  9. Sharps containers and regulated medical waste accessories.
  10. Biohazard specimen bags, absorbent materials, labels, and transport packaging.

Specialized products may require additional planning. Examples include pediatric collection tubes, Blood Culture bottles, trace-element tubes, molecular transport systems, therapeutic drug-monitoring tubes, special preservatives, and products requiring refrigeration. These items may have lower demand, narrower compatibility requirements, and more limited distribution.

Before ordering any tube or collection device, compare the manufacturer catalog number, tube size, additive, closure color, draw volume, expiration date, and intended test type. Cap colors are not perfectly universal across every product line, and a similar-looking tube may contain a different additive. Laboratory procedures and test directories should control the selection.

How Fast Is “Fast Shipping” for Medical Supplies?

Shipping terminology varies between vendors. “In stock” may mean that the vendor has the product in its own warehouse, while “available” may mean that the vendor can obtain it from another location. “Next-day delivery” may refer to the next business day rather than the next calendar day. Orders placed after a daily cutoff, on weekends, or around federal holidays may not ship until the following business day.

For procurement purposes, buyers should distinguish between these delivery categories:

  1. Same-day pickup: The facility collects the order from a local branch or warehouse, subject to confirmed inventory.
  2. Same-day local delivery: A local supplier delivers within a defined service area, often with a minimum order or delivery fee.
  3. Next-business-day delivery: The order ships by a specified carrier service and arrives on the following business day in eligible ZIP Codes.
  4. Two- to three-business-day delivery: A common standard for stocked medical supplies ordered from regional warehouses.
  5. Expedited overnight delivery: A premium service that may deliver the next morning, afternoon, or end of day depending on the destination and carrier.
  6. Emergency courier service: A specialized local service that may be arranged outside standard shipping schedules at a substantially higher cost.

The fastest option is not necessarily the most reliable. Carrier delays, severe weather, rural delivery routes, incorrect addresses, and warehouse cutoffs can affect arrival times. A clinic should obtain an order confirmation with a shipment date and tracking information rather than relying only on an estimated delivery window displayed before checkout.

Regulatory and Quality Requirements for U.S. Purchasers

Occupational safety

OSHA’s Bloodborne Pathogens Standard, found at 29 CFR 1910.1030, requires employers with occupational exposure to blood or other potentially infectious materials to use appropriate protective measures. The standard addresses exposure-control plans, engineering controls, work-practice controls, personal protective equipment, training, hepatitis B vaccination, post-exposure evaluation, and recordkeeping.

The Needlestick Safety and Prevention Act strengthened requirements related to safer medical devices and employee input in selecting and evaluating engineering controls. For phlebotomy purchasing, this means a facility should evaluate safety-engineered needles, retractable devices, needleless systems where appropriate, and sharps containers. The cheapest conventional device may not be the best choice if a safer product reduces occupational risk.

Purchasers should also verify that sharps containers are appropriate for the type and volume of waste generated. A container that is too small can fill quickly, while one that is too large may be difficult to position near the point of use. Containers should be closable, leak-resistant on the sides and bottom, puncture-resistant, and labeled or color-coded according to applicable requirements.

FDA and product identification

Many medical devices used in blood collection are regulated by the U.S. Food and Drug Administration. Buyers should maintain manufacturer names, catalog numbers, lot numbers, and purchase records. The FDA’s Unique Device Identification system is designed to improve the identification of medical devices through distribution and use, although the specific information available depends on the product and its labeling.

A facility should purchase from reputable sources and retain documentation for recalls, investigations, and quality reviews. If a supplier offers a product described only as “equivalent,” the laboratory or clinical leadership should determine whether it is acceptable before use.

CLIA and laboratory compatibility

The Clinical Laboratory Improvement Amendments establish quality requirements for human laboratory testing in the United States. Collection devices can affect Specimen Integrity and test performance. Tube type, fill volume, mixing technique, Clotting Time, transport temperature, centrifugation, and processing time can all influence results.

Changing a collection tube brand or model may require review by the laboratory director, quality manager, or medical director. Some facilities may need verification, validation, or documentation before implementing a new product. A fast shipment does not justify bypassing these controls.

Packaging, labeling, and storage

When supplies arrive, staff should inspect the shipping carton and inner packaging. Sterile packages should be intact. Boxes should not show evidence of water damage, crushing, punctures, broken seals, or tampering. Products requiring temperature control should be checked against the manufacturer’s storage instructions.

Most routine needles, tubes, gloves, gauze, and labels are stored at controlled room temperature, but exact requirements vary. Some products can be damaged by excessive heat, freezing, humidity, or direct sunlight. The facility should rotate stock using a first-expire, first-out system and avoid placing boxes directly on the floor.

How to Compare Suppliers Beyond the Listed Price

Shipping cost can change the economics of a purchase. A product with a lower unit price may become more expensive after freight, handling charges, minimum-order requirements, expedited delivery, and disposal of unused or expired stock. A practical comparison should calculate the total delivered cost.

  1. Unit price: Compare the cost per tube, needle, collection set, or complete procedure rather than only the carton price.
  2. Pack size: Confirm how many units are included and whether the facility can use the entire quantity before expiration.
  3. Freight: Review standard, expedited, residential, rural, and special-handling charges.
  4. Availability: Ask whether the stated quantity is physically in stock and where it will ship from.
  5. Expiration: Request the minimum remaining shelf life for products with expiration dates.
  6. Returns: Check restocking fees, return deadlines, unopened-product requirements, and policies for temperature-sensitive items.
  7. Substitutions: Determine whether the vendor may replace an ordered item without prior approval.
  8. Documentation: Confirm that invoices identify product numbers, quantities, lots, and shipping details when applicable.
  9. Customer support: Evaluate whether the supplier offers a reachable representative during business hours and an emergency contact process.

For recurring purchases, a written supply agreement can improve reliability. The agreement may define delivery performance, back-order notifications, approved substitutions, quality complaints, recall communication, and service-level expectations. Larger organizations may use vendor scorecards that track fill rate, order accuracy, on-time delivery, damaged shipments, and invoice errors.

What to Do When a Product Is Backordered

Backorders can affect even common supplies during periods of high demand, manufacturing interruptions, transportation problems, or sudden public health events. The response should be organized rather than improvised.

  1. Confirm the expected replenishment date and whether the date is guaranteed or only an estimate.
  2. Ask whether the vendor has an identical product in another warehouse.
  3. Check whether the manufacturer has approved alternate catalog numbers or package sizes.
  4. Ask the laboratory director or clinical leadership whether a substitute is acceptable.
  5. Review tube additives, dimensions, draw volume, sterility, safety features, and analyzer compatibility before substitution.
  6. Document the approval, implementation date, staff communication, and any required procedure changes.
  7. Search the facility’s other approved suppliers rather than relying on an unknown reseller.
  8. Place a normal replenishment order after the emergency is resolved so the facility does not remain vulnerable to another shortage.

Facilities should avoid transferring supplies into unlabeled bags or combining different products in a way that obscures lot numbers and expiration dates. Traceability is important when a product is recalled or a specimen-quality problem is investigated.

Building a Fast and Reliable Purchasing Strategy

Calculate par levels

A par level is the target quantity that should normally be available. It should reflect average usage, seasonal variation, supplier lead time, storage capacity, and the consequences of stockout. A small office that draws 50 patients per week may need a different safety stock than a high-volume outpatient laboratory performing several hundred collections per day.

Usage data can be obtained from purchasing records, inventory counts, electronic health record utilization, and laboratory test volumes. A simple calculation can include average weekly consumption plus the expected usage during the supplier’s lead time and an additional safety margin. The margin should be larger for products with limited substitutes or unpredictable demand.

Use two approved suppliers

Maintaining a primary and secondary approved supplier can reduce operational risk. The backup supplier should be evaluated in advance, not during a crisis. Staff should know the account number, ordering process, accepted payment method, cutoff time, and approved substitute list.

Dual sourcing does not mean buying random products from multiple vendors. The facility should maintain a controlled list of acceptable manufacturers and catalog numbers. This allows purchasing staff to move quickly while preserving clinical and quality requirements.

Organize emergency ordering authority

Fast procurement is easier when the organization has clear approval rules. A policy may identify who can authorize expedited freight, which products can be purchased without additional clinical review, and which substitutions require laboratory or medical director approval. It should also explain how emergency purchases are documented after the fact.

For small practices, a short written procedure can prevent delays. It may include the preferred supplier, account details, delivery address, normal order cutoff, emergency contact, approved products, and escalation steps. Access to the supplier account should be limited to authorized staff, but more than one trained employee should know how to place an order.

Monitor supplier performance

On-time delivery is only one measure of supplier performance. A vendor that delivers quickly but repeatedly sends incorrect products creates additional clinical and administrative work. Facilities can monitor the following indicators:

  1. Percentage of orders delivered by the promised date.
  2. Percentage of ordered units shipped without back-order.
  3. Frequency of incorrect, damaged, or short shipments.
  4. Number of products arriving with unacceptable shelf life.
  5. Time required to resolve credits, returns, and quality complaints.
  6. Accuracy of invoices and purchase-order matching.
  7. Responsiveness during shortages, recalls, and urgent requests.

Special Considerations for Mobile and Small-Volume Phlebotomy Services

Mobile Phlebotomy services often need a compact supply assortment that can be transported safely to homes, workplaces, nursing facilities, and community events. These organizations may benefit from suppliers that offer smaller case quantities and predictable delivery rather than hospital-sized bulk cartons.

Mobile staff should carry enough supplies for scheduled collections plus a contingency amount for difficult draws, repeat collections, unexpected patients, and damaged items. They should also have a clear process for transporting specimens in compliance with applicable laboratory and carrier requirements. Phlebotomy supplies and patient specimens are separate purchasing categories: the rules for shipping a specimen may differ from the rules for shipping unused needles or collection tubes.

Small practices should be especially careful with expiration dates. Buying a large discounted case may appear economical but can lead to waste if the practice performs too few collections to use the products before expiration. Smaller cartons, standing orders, or scheduled monthly deliveries may produce a lower total cost.

How to Place an Urgent Order Successfully

When time is limited, provide the supplier with precise information. The order should include the manufacturer, catalog number, product description, package size, quantity, delivery address, contact person, and required arrival date. Avoid descriptions such as “blue-top tubes” or “butterfly needles” without specifying the exact product because similar items may have different dimensions or additives.

Ask the supplier to confirm the following before payment:

  1. The exact product and manufacturer.
  2. The quantity physically available.
  3. The warehouse or fulfillment location.
  4. The order cutoff time.
  5. The shipping method and carrier.
  6. The expected delivery date and time window.
  7. Any premium freight, handling, or minimum-order charges.
  8. Whether the order may be split into multiple shipments.
  9. Whether substitutions will occur without prior authorization.
  10. The process for reporting damage, shortages, or incorrect products.

After delivery, inspect the shipment promptly. Compare the packing slip with the purchase order, verify the product numbers, count the cartons, and check for damage. Store the supplies according to manufacturer instructions and record the receipt in the inventory system. If an urgent shipment is incomplete, contact the supplier immediately rather than waiting until the next routine inventory review.

Final Guidance for Choosing a Fast-Shipping Supplier

For most U.S. clinics, the most practical approach is to establish a relationship with a national medical distributor or specialty laboratory supplier for routine orders, while maintaining a local backup source for urgent needs. A manufacturer-direct account may be worthwhile for high-volume facilities with standardized products and predictable demand. Online medical supply stores can be convenient for common accessories, but the seller’s identity and product traceability should be verified.

The fastest supplier is the one that can consistently provide the correct product, in the correct quantity, with adequate shelf life and dependable documentation. Delivery speed should be confirmed rather than assumed. Inventory should be forecast using actual usage data, and critical items should have reasonable safety stock. Approved alternatives should be evaluated before a shortage occurs.

In the United States, responsible phlebotomy purchasing combines logistics with patient and worker safety. OSHA requirements, CLIA expectations, FDA-regulated device considerations, laboratory procedures, manufacturer instructions, and state-specific rules all influence the buying decision. By comparing total delivered cost, monitoring vendor performance, and preparing a backup plan, healthcare organizations can obtain phlebotomy supplies quickly without sacrificing quality or compliance.
